Statement on Race and Social Equity

On June 24, 2020, the CPL Board endorsed Canadian Urban Libraries Council’s Statement on Race and Social Equity, as an aspirational goal.

Tri-Cities Children's Accord

The communities of Anmore, Belcarra, Coquitlam, Port Coquitlam and Port Moody agree that the Early and Middle Childhood Years (birth to 12 years) are critical in the healthy development and future well-being of children in our communities. These values are outlined in the Tri-Cities Children's Accord.
